SourceForge开始全面支持Subversion,这真是个好消息,这预示着CVS独霸天下的时代快要结束,SVN时代就要来临。
和CVS比起来,SVN的确很强大,这就像它的出现就是为了取代CVS一样,它的目标快要实现了。
具体的功能特性大家可以上Subversion官方网站查看,这里没必要给出那段生涩不好翻译的英语短句了。
官方中文网站在这儿,不过这个站的网络通讯太差劲了,一个礼拜5天都上不去:(
欣慰的是这里有个网站提供一本免费的、非常棒的SVN图书,可以选择在线查看或者下载PDF,有中文版哦,SVN使用者必读。
如果你对SVN还是表示怀疑可以在这里查看国外网友写的一篇各个版本控制系统功能比较的文章,相信看过后你不会再对SVN表示怀疑了。
英文看不懂?幸好,有网友将那篇生涩的英文SVN特性用生涩的中文表述出来了 ,中文英文对照着看,凑合着还行。
冲动的你这时已经手痒痒的想尝试下SVN的魅力,但苦于现在的项目已经建立在CVS上。别担心,这里正好有一篇文章介绍如何将CVS的Repository转换成SNV,转换方法来自这个程序http://cvs2svn.tigris.org/。
如何使用SVN我这里不再介绍,官方的那本书是最好的教程,网上还有大量的安装和使用的文章可以借鉴,这里简单罗列几个SVN辅助的软件:
1、SubVersion,从 http://subversion.tigris.org/ 下载,是实现服务系统的软件,必装的。
2、TortoiseSVN,从 http://tortoisesvn.tigris.org/ 下载,是很不错的SVN客户端程序,为windows外壳程序集成到windows资源管理器和文件管理系统的Subversion客户端,用起来很方便,commit动作变得就像Winrar右键压缩一样方便。
3、SVNService.exe,从 http://dark.clansoft.dk/~mbn/svnservice/ 下载,是专为 SubVersion 开发的一个用来作为 Win32 服务挂接的入口程序。
4、AnkhSVN,从http://ankhsvn.tigris.org/下载,这是一个专为Visual Studio提供SVN的插件。
5、Subversive,从http://www.polarion.org/p_subversive.php下载,这时一个为Eclipse提供SVN的插件,据说已经和Eclipse自带的CVS功能有一拼。
6、还有很多很多SVN相关的工具以及使用TIP介绍,大家可以上官方的相关链接页面中查看,地址:http://subversion.tigris.org/links.html
分享到:
相关推荐
在当今数字化时代,无论是个人开发者还是企业团队,都需要高效地管理代码版本以及提供便捷的Web服务访问。本文将详细介绍如何通过路由器配置来实现对本地计算机上的Web服务和Subversion (SVN)服务进行远程访问的方法...
在数字化时代,多媒体播放器是每个电脑用户不可或缺的工具之一。mplayer,作为一款广受赞誉的开源播放器,因其强大的兼容性和跨平台特性而备受推崇。本文将深入探讨mplayer-SVN-2010.10.19.zip这个版本的特性,以及...
- **支持更大的文件**:提升了单个文件的最大大小限制,适应了大数据时代的需要。 通过 myeclipse 集成 SVN1.10 插件,开发者可以享受到这些改进带来的便利,实现更高效、稳定的团队协作。在实际开发过程中,熟悉 ...
这份手册是Subversion 1.4时代的权威指南,对于开发者、项目经理和团队成员来说,是理解和掌握SVN不可或缺的参考资料。通过深入学习,你可以充分利用SVN的功能,优化团队协作,提高软件开发效率。
8. **支持更大的文件和更大的仓库**:Subversion 1.8增加了对大文件和大仓库的支持,能够处理GB级别的文件,满足了大数据时代的需求。 9. **多语言支持**:Subversion 1.8支持多种语言,包括但不限于英文、中文等,...
《TortoiseSVN-1.8.10.26129-win32-svn:XP与Win7时代的版本控制利器》 TortoiseSVN,这是一款深受开发者喜爱的版本控制系统客户端,尤其在XP和Win7操作系统中表现卓越。其1.8.10版本的发布,为用户提供了稳定且...
TortoiseSVN支持多种编程语言的项目管理,广泛应用于软件开发团队和内容创作团队,以确保多人协作时代码或文档的一致性和历史记录。 **安装过程** 1. **下载安装包**:首先,你需要从官方网站或者其他可信源下载...
总的来说,DOSBox_SVN_MB6b.zip提供的这个DOSBox版本是一个强大的工具,不仅能让用户重温经典的DOS时代,也为开发者和爱好者提供了研究和调试DOS程序的平台。通过深入理解DOSBox的工作原理和利用其debug面板,我们...
由于 XE5 时代 Delphi 安装体积急剧膨胀(完整安装接近 10G,程序文件、安装缓存超过 20G+),按照过去的方式打包,XE5 的 lite 体积 1.xG,接近 PE image 理论极限,而且当前 XE5 支持 x86、x64、osx、ios、android...
在当今信息化时代,软件开发项目的管理变得越来越复杂,而有效的工具则成为了提升效率的关键。"release_v1.0.zip"这个压缩包文件,正是为了解决这个问题而提供的一个解决方案,它包含了一款禅道(Zentao)的SVN...
同时,也需要借助一些工具,如代码编辑工具(WebStorm、VS Code)、代码版本控制工具(Git、SVN)、代码包管理工具(npm、Yarn)、前端构建工具(Webpack、Vite)等,来提升开发效率和质量。 总的来说,前端开发是...
在当今互联网时代,博客作为个人分享知识与经验的重要平台,越来越受到人们的喜爱。而利用高效便捷的开发框架,如CakePHP,可以在短时间内构建出一个功能完备的博客系统。本文档基于“cakphp15分钟建博客”的主题,...
在信息化时代,网络安全与便捷性成为了企业和个人用户的重要需求。深信服科技作为国内知名的网络安全解决方案提供商,为了解决用户在使用其产品时可能遇到的环境问题,特别推出了SangforHelperToolInstaller.zip...
在数字化时代,面对海量的文件,如何高效地比较和管理显得尤为重要。BCompare(Beyond Compare)就是这样一款强大的文件和文件夹比较工具,它以其出色的性能和易用性赢得了广大用户的青睐。本文将深入探讨BCompare的...
TortoiseSVN是一款非常流行的图形化SVN客户端,广泛用于Windows平台,它在与SVN服务器交互时会自动记住用户的登录凭据,以方便下次使用。这些信息通常被安全地存储在Windows的凭据管理器中,普通用户很难直接查看或...
5. **集成IDE**:可以与流行的版本控制系统如Git、SVN等无缝集成,提供直观的差异查看和合并操作。 6. **命令行工具**:提供了命令行接口,便于自动化脚本和批量处理任务。 描述中提到的"flush Get等工具"可能指的...
《深入理解Lomboz HibernateIDE:基于R-3.3-200710290621版本的...通过解压并研究这个压缩包中的"eclipse"文件,我们可以回顾那个时代开发者的工具选择,理解他们是如何利用这些工具进行高效的Java和Hibernate开发的。
1.1 黑暗的史前时代/ 2 1.2 CVS—开启版本控制大爆发/ 5 1.3 SVN—集中式版本控制集大成者/ 7 1.4 Git—Linus 的第二个伟大作品/ 9 第2章 爱上 Git 的理由/ 11 2.1 每日工作备份/ 11 2.2 异地协同工作/ 12 2.3 现场...